      Christmas on TV

      just thought i'd look and see what was going to be on over the christmas period


      BBC

      Wallace and Gromit are this year's cover stars to celebrate their new adventure A Matter of Loaf and Death. We have exclusive shots of the claymation pair and talk to creator Nick Park - plus, there's a great poster offer

      * Strictly Come Dancing's head judge Len Goodman takes Hazel Blears MP for a spin on the dancefloor

      * There's double the fun and Cybermen too in this year's Doctor Who Christmas special! And there's another exclusive poster offer

      * Jonathan Creek's Alan Davies reveals what's brought him back to this magic role

      * Top Gear's Richard Hammond on the team's latest prank - a two-wheeled race through Vietnam

      * Rich and poor celebrate in a charming special episode of Lark Rise to Candleford

      * Robson Green and Mark Benton raid the dressing-up box for Clash of the Santas

      * The Royle Family are back on our screens this Yuletide and, shockingly, this time they're leaving the living room!

      * Rupert Penry-Jones fulfils a childhood wish in the stirring tale of The 39 Steps
